Sweden votes for EU tariffs against Trump: "Puts pressure"Jacob Ruderstam
Updated 15.48 | Published 13.50
Sweden is behind the list of American goods to be covered.
- This will put pressure on the Americans, says Minister of Development Cooperation and Foreign Trade Benjamin Dousa (M).
Donald Trump's import tariffs have been high on the EU's agenda recently. Member states have discussed which American goods should be covered by the retaliatory tariffs aimed at the US. During the afternoon, the Union voted in favor of the list, which contains around 1,600 goods.
Sweden votes in favor
Sweden is among the countries that voted to introduce the counter-tariffs, according to Minister of Development Cooperation and Foreign Trade Benjamin Dousa (M).- We think it is a well-crafted list that will put pressure on the US to sit down at the negotiating table with us, he tells Aftonbladet.

Put pressure on the US
The purpose of the countermeasures is also to make it clear to Trump and his administration that the high tariffs are bad, says Dousa.- This will put pressure on the Americans and make it clear that what they are doing is not sustainable if they do not want to push the entire American economy into recession. If they stick to the tariff rates, it will lead to a significant deterioration in the American economy.
“It is incomprehensible”
The EU is not alone in being affected by the US president's tariffs. Countries such as China and Canada have already responded by introducing countermeasures in response to Trump's measures. According to the Swedish Minister of Trade, there is no doubt who is responsible for the situation that has arisen.- If you look at previous crises like the pandemic or the financial crisis, none of them were created by politics and in a conscious way. The US was doing really well, tech companies started and investors came. Now they are pushing back the country's economy, it is incomprehensible, says Dousa.
EU tariffs against the US will be introduced on April 15.
